KENNETH M. COLQUHOUN, OF OWATONNA, MINNESOTA.
SPARK-ARRESTER.
S'peecation of Letters'Patent.
Patented Feb. 25, 1908:
Application filed May 22. 1907. Serial No., 375.162.
To all whom it may concern:
Be it known that I, KENNETH M. CoLQU- HOUN, of Owatonna, Steele county, Minnesota, have invented certain new and useful Improvements in Spark-Arresters, of which the following is a speciiication.
My invention relates to spark-arresters applicable to the smoke stacks of boilers generally but particularly adapted for use on threshing machine engines and Where lignite coal or strawv is used for fuel.
The invention consists generally in various constructions and combinations, all as hereinafter described and particularly pointed out in the claims.
In the accompanying drawings, forming part-of this speciiication, Figure 1 is a side elevation Jartially in section, of a boiler and stack with my invention applied thereto. Fig. 2 is a sectional view on the line x-:Jc of Fig. 1. Fig. 3 is a sectional view on the line @/-fy of Fig. 1.
In the drawing, 2 represents a boiler having an exhaust nozzle 3, and a stack 4.
5 is a circular plate having a central opening to receive the top of the stack and having a depending iiange 6 around said opening between which flange and the top of the stack a ring 7 is secured. Straps 8 extend up beside the stack upon the ange 6 and the ring 7, and the lower ends of said straps are connected by a ring 9, the ends of which are provided 'with a clamp device 10 for operating the ring snugly around the stack. The straps 8 extend above the top` of the stack and have inwardly inclined upper portions 11 which cross one another at the top of the arrester and are secured to the imperforate top plate 12 by a bolt 18. A ring 14 of substantially the same diameter as the top of the stack, is secured to the straps 8 and at the base of their inwardly inclinedportions, and a second ring 15 is provided near the top of the said straps, and between these rings a wire mesh 16 1s secured, forming a cone or hood over the top of the stack.
A pipe 17 has its upper end curved in to overhang the opening in the upper end of the cone and said pipe extends down beside the cone and into the stack, and has an open lower end near the nozzle 3. A considerable portion of the cinders blown up through the stack will pass into the cone and from thence be directed down the pipe 17 into the cinder box provided at the forward end of the boiler. The cover 12 is convex in form vide a series of circular screens spaced from one another and of sufficiently fine mesh to prevent the sparks or burning particles of coal or straw from being blown out of the and between it and the bottom plate 5 I prostack while the engine is in operation. I
may provide any suitable number of these screens. In this case I have shown three arranged one within another. The outer screen consists of an upper ring 18 and lower ring 19 connected by a filler 2O of suitable wire mesh. Vertical straps 21 connect the rings at intervals and have ears 22 formed on their ends that are detachably secured to the top and bottom of the arrester by bolts 23.
Vithin the outer screen, rings 24 and 25 are provided connected by a screen 26 and secured to the top and bottom of the arrester in the same manner as described with reference to the irst screen. The third screen is located within the second one and comprises rings 27 and 28 connected by a screen 29 and secured to the plates 5 and 12 in the same manner as' the other screens; The outer screen is permanently mounted, preferably, while the inner ones are capable of convenient attachment according to the character of the fuel that is being burned and the danger of rire from flying s arks. The rings 25 and 28 are adjusted a suA cient distance above the plate 5 so that any material passing through these screens and dropping down upon the plate will slide thereover under the rings and into the open top of the stack. The screens may be made of dierent mesh and by removing the top plate access may be had to them for removal or repairs.
This arrester is of very simple construction and can be readily applied to any type of stack and will positively prevent the discharge of sparks or burning embers and thereby eliminate all danger of fire around a threshing engine.
